Transaction 3074c44d4ef82a64fa294deafa732c2b8543f75a195c9ca836516f59a248153b
1 Input
1 Output
-
3074c44d4ef82a64fa294deafa732c2b8543f75a195c9ca836516f59a248153b:0
- value
- 52997
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cad04fec2c3718cb0dcd50aef601c901e8579340 OP_EQUAL
- address
- 3LBPy5X4z8jPyMXW5qFKHZdkHxpWVzabSB